5 Benefits Of Working In A Part Time Job While Studying

Devi Bhuvanesh 7 years ago

Are you a student and want to earn money at the same time? Being a college going student, you might need money for various reasons such as to go for a trip, to eat at your favourite restaurant, transport cost, to buy books, etc. To fulfil all your needs on your own without asking money from others, doing part time jobs will be of great help.

There are several other benefits of doing part time jobs. Read below to know more:

1. Learn to manage expenses

You get to learn on your own and this will, in turn, help you to use your money effectively. We, humans, always crave for something more than what we have. Doing a part time job will make you independent and manage your needs with the money you have. Hence, you will learn to save money also.

2. Improve your time management skills

It’s quite difficult to balance both, studies and work. A part time job offers flexibility to work according to your schedule. These jobs mostly don't require you to work on all days. It might be either on weekends or on alternate days which varies from company to company. This way, you will certainly improve your time management skills.

3. Professional experience and exposure

If you would like to explore the field you are interested in, working as a part time in a related firm is a great way to improve your skills. It will give a professional experience and exposure in the industry. You will get an idea of how it works and get an effective job training.

4. Understand the industry

By working in a company as part time, you will get to know about each department and how it works. There will be several roles and you can interact with the professionals and understand their work nature. It’s a great learning opportunity to observe things and know the skills required for each role.

5. Boosts your resume

Having a work experience as part time in the field you are interested in, will boost your resume. It indicates your interest, passion, and motivation to learn in the field. This will help you know what the industry wants and prepare yourself for the same.

Even though studies being the top priority, a part time job experience will add on to your exposure and provide practical knowledge which will be a way to figure out what you exactly want to do.
